入排标准
入选标准
- •1Women of reproductive age (18-40yrs) diagnosed with PCOS by gynaecologist/ physician
- •2 able to understand research procedures and provide informed consent
- •3willingness to undergo study protocols
- •4willing to exercise for the entire study duration
- •5willing to undergo required study related assessments
排除标准
- •1Women participating in a regular high-intensity endurance or strength training (defined as _ 2 sessions of vigorous exercise per week),
- •2Physical ailments/injuries that limit exercise performance,
- •3History of cardiovascular ,kidney disease, respiratory disease, uncontrolled hypertension (resting BP >140/90 mmHg) or cancer, hypothyroidism, neurological disease, musculoskeletal condition affecting knee , hip and ankle joints and foot;
- •4 use of cigarettes for >6 months;
- •5Recent decrease of body weight change by 5kg or more in previous 6 months
- •6acute or chronic medical condition that would make assessment and interventions potentially hazardous or any of the outcomes impossible to assess
